Design of the No Frost system: the role of the fan in the cooling cycle
Technology No Frost (translated as “no frost”) is based on forced circulation of cold air. Unlike drip refrigerators, where cooling occurs due to natural convection, here it is involved fan, which evenly distributes the flows across all compartments. This allows you to avoid the formation of ice on the walls and maintain a stable temperature.
Structurally, the system includes:
- 🔹 Evaporator — located behind the back wall (in the freezer or refrigerator compartment, depending on the model). This is where the refrigerant picks up heat.
- 🔹 Fan - installed next to the evaporator. Its blades drive air through the cooled fins and then direct it into the chambers.
- 🔹 Defrost heating element - turns on periodically to melt the ice on the evaporator (usually once every 8-12 hours).
- 🔹 Temperature sensors —control the operating mode of the compressor and fan.
- 🔹 Control board —the “brain” of the system that coordinates all processes.
Fan No Frost does not work constantly, but cyclically. When the compressor turns on and the temperature in the evaporator drops to a predetermined level, the blades begin to rotate, creating a flow of cold air. As soon as the sensor detects that the desired temperature has been reached, the fan stops. This process is repeated many times during the day.
Causes of fan noise: when is it normal and when is it a breakdown
Many users complain about extraneous sounds from the refrigerator: buzzing, crackling or periodic “clicking”. In most cases, this is due to the operation of the fan. But how to distinguish normal noise from signs of a malfunction?
Normal sounds:
- 🔊 Even humming - occurs when the blades rotate. It can intensify under high load (for example, after loading warm products).
- 🔊 Short-term crackling - sometimes heard when starting or stopping the fan (due to the inertia of the motor).
- 🔊 Air noise - flows pass through air ducts, especially noticeable in models with Multi Air Flow (for example, Samsung RB37J5230SS).
Symptoms of malfunction:
- ⚠️ Grinding or squealing - indicates wear of the bearings or the ingress of a foreign object (for example, a piece of packaging).
- ⚠️ Strong vibration - can be caused by unbalancing of the blades or loose fastenings.
- ⚠️ Intermittent operation - the fan either turns on or stops abruptly (the reason is problems with power supply or sensors).
- ⚠️ No noise at all — if the refrigerator is working, but the air does not circulate, the fan may be broken.
⚠️ Attention: If noise is accompanied increase in temperature in the chambers or formation of ice on the back wall, this is a sure sign that the fan is not doing its job. In such cases. It is recommended turn off the refrigerator and check the system for blockages or mechanical damage.
Why can the fan make more noise at night?
At night, the fan often works louder for two reasons:
1. Lower room temperature — the compressor turns on less often, but when this happens, the temperature difference between inside and outside the chamber is higher, so the fan works more intensely.
2. Lack of background noise — During the day, the sound of the fan is “masked” by household noises (TV, conversations), and at night it becomes more noticeable.
Why the fan stops working: top 5 reasons
If the fan in the refrigerator No Frost stops rotating, this can be due to both mechanical failures and problems in the electrical circuit. Let's consider the most common reasons:
- Icing of the blades. If the defrost heating element fails or the defrost sensor gives incorrect signals, the evaporator becomes covered with ice, blocking the rotation of the fan. Most often this happens in the freezers of refrigerators. data-i="113">and Indesit And Ariston over 5 years.
- Ingress of foreign objects. Pieces of cling film, labels or even ice crystals can jam the blades in some models (LG GA-B489YDQZ) for protection. a mesh is installed, but it does not always save.
- Wear of the bearings or. engine. Over time, the lubricant in the bearings dries out, which leads to increased friction and final stoppage, typical for refrigerators that have been in operation for more than 7-8 years.
- Power problems. Oxidation of contacts on the control board, broken wires or failure of the relay can interrupt the supply of voltage to the fan. For example, Samsung RL-44 QEBS the CN10 connector on the main board often suffers.
- Faulty sensors. If the temperature sensor evaporator (defrost sensor) transmits incorrect data, the control board may block the fan from starting, fearing icing.

How to check the fan yourself: step-by-step instructions
If you suspect that the fan is not working, you can test it without calling a technician. To do this, you will need: a screwdriver (usually a Phillips head), a multimeter (to check the voltage) and a flashlight. Follow the algorithm:
Step 1. Disconnect and. defrosting.
Unplug the refrigerator and leave it with the doors open for 1-2 hours. This is necessary to melt any possible ice on the evaporator. In models with Full No Frost (for example, Bosch KGE39XW2AR), defrosting takes less time.
Step 2. Removing the protective panel.
In most refrigerators, the fan is located behind the plastic panel in the freezer. To remove it:
- Unscrew the screws around the perimeter (usually 4-6 pieces).
- Carefully pry the panel with a screwdriver and remove it. Be careful - there may be wires behind it!
Step 3. Visual inspection.
Inspect the fan and evaporator:
- 🔍 There should be no ice, snow or debris on the blades.
- 🔍 Check integrity wires leading to the engine.
- 🔍 Make sure there is no play on the fan shaft (rock the blades up and down).
Step 4. Check rotation.
Try to rotate the blades by hand. If they:
- 🔄 They rotate easily - the problem may be electrical.
- 🔄 They stick or do not rotate - most likely a mechanical failure (bearing, ice).
Step 5. Power test.
If the fan rotates freely, but does not work when the refrigerator is turned on:
- Connect a multimeter in voltage measurement mode to the fan contacts (usually a connector with 2-3 wires).
- Turn on the refrigerator and wait until the compressor starts. The voltage should be
12–24 V(depending on the model). - If there is voltage, but the fan does not spin, it has burned out. If there is no voltage, the problem is in the board or wires.
⚠️ Attention: In refrigerators with inverter compressor (for example, LG InstaView), the fan may turn on with a delay of up to 5-10 minutes after startup. Do not rush to draw conclusions about the breakdown if the blades do not work right away!
Table: Symptoms of fan malfunction and their causes
| Symptom | Probable cause | What to do |
|---|---|---|
| The fan does not rotate, but there is voltage | The fan motor has burned out | Replace the fan (the part number is indicated on the sticker) |
| The fan is noisy and vibrates | Wear of the bearings or imbalance of the blades | Lubricate the bearings or replace the fan |
| The blades are blocked by ice | The heating element does not work defrost or sensor | Defrost the refrigerator, check the heating element (resistance 20–60 Ohm) |
| The fan runs jerkily | Problems with the control board or sensors | Diagnose the board, check the contacts |
| The fan does not turn on, but the compressor works | Broken wire or oxidation of contacts | Ring the circuit with a multimeter, clean the contacts |
How to replace the fan in the refrigerator No Frost: tips and nuances
If diagnostics show that the fan is faulty, you will have to replace it. In most cases, you can do this yourself, without resorting to the services of a service center. Tools and materials:
- 🔧 Phillips screwdriver.
- 🔧 Pliers (for removing clamps).
- 🔧 Multimeter (to check the new fan before installation).
- 🔧 Heat-shrink tubing or electrical tape (to insulate contacts).
Step-by-step replacement:
- Disconnect the refrigerator and defrost it (at least 2 hours).
- Remove the back panel freezer (as described above).
- Disconnect the power connector from the fan. Be careful - the wires are fragile!
- Unscrew the screwsthat secure the fan to the case (usually 2-3 pieces).
- Remove the old fan and install a new one, securing it with screws.
- Connect the connector and check that the wires are not strained.
- Put the panel in place and turn on the refrigerator. After 5-10 minutes the fan should start working.

Prevention of breakdowns: how to extend the life of a fan
The service life of a fan in a refrigerator No Frost depends not only on the quality of the parts, but also on the operating conditions. By following simple recommendations, you can avoid most of them. problems:
- 🧊 Regular defrosting. Even in systems No Frost every 6-12 months you need to turn off the refrigerator and let it thaw. This prevents ice from accumulating on the evaporator.
- 🍎 Proper placement of products. Do not place packages close to the back wall - this is blocks the air ducts and forces the fan to work with increased load.
- 🧹 Cleaning the air ducts. Dust and grease accumulating on the grilles impair air circulation. Wipe them with a damp cloth once every 3 months.

FAQ: Frequently asked questions about the fan in the No Frost refrigerator
❓ Why does the fan work constantly without stopping?
If the fan does not turn off, this may be due to:
- 🔹 Faulty temperature sensor —it “thinks” that the chamber is warm and makes the fan work without stopping.
- 🔹 Clogged air ducts —cold air does not enter the chambers, and the system tries to compensate for this by increasing the operation of the fan.
- 🔹 Failure of the control board —it can give false commands for continuous operation.
Solution: check the sensors with a multimeter (the resistance should change as the temperature changes) and clean the air ducts.
❓ Is it possible to operate the refrigerator if the fan is broken?
Technically yes, but not. recommendedWithout a fan:
- 🔹 The temperature in the chambers will be uneven (colder at the bottom, warmer at the top).
- 🔹 Ice will begin to build up on the back wall, which will worsen the operation of the compressor.
- 🔹 Products will spoil faster due to insufficient air circulation.
If replacing the fan is not possible immediately, reduce the load on the refrigerator and defrost it more often.
❓ What is the service life of the fan in the refrigerator?
On average, the fan is designed for 5–10 years work, but this period depends from:
- 🔹 Build quality —fans in premium models (Liebherr, Miele) last longer.
- 🔹 Operating conditions —frequent voltage drops or high humidity reduce resource.
- 🔹 Service regularity - cleaning and defrosting prolong the life of parts.
Signs of wear: increased noise, vibration, slow rotation of blades.
❓ Why did the refrigerator become more noisy after replacing the fan?
Possible reasons:
- 🔹 Incorrect installation —the fan touches the housing or air duct.
- 🔹 Imbalance of the blades —one of the blades may have been bent during transportation or installation.
- 🔹 Incompatible model —the new fan has different speed or power.
Solution: check the fastenings, rotate the blades by hand (they should rotate smoothly) and compare the article number of the new fan with the old one.
❓ Is it possible to lubricate the fan if it squeaks?
Yes, but only if the problem is in the bearings. To do this:
- Remove the fan (as described above).
- Remove old grease from the shaft and bearings (you can use alcohol).
- Apply silicone or lithium grease (do not use oils based on petroleum products!).
- Rotate the blades so that the lubricant is distributed evenly.
If the squeak remains, the bearings are worn out and the fan needs to be replaced.
